#14bc8b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#14bc8b is composed of 7.8% red, 73.7%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.1%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 162.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 40.8%. #14bc8b color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#007917.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#14bc8b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b08 is the darkest color, while #f8f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#14bc8b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646c6a is the less saturated color, while #04cc92 is the most saturated one.
